Might be nice to start off fresh and simple. I can't find the story I wrote before so I'll just start fresh. This will be a cute little love story about a socially awkward boy named Mathew trying to fit into his new town and new school as well. And it will tell another story of a prestigious boy named Richard, who will be the generally liked boi in school. He has lots of friends and never really lived a tough life. Until now. Once he figures out how hard and cruel life can be, he also sees how fake his friends really are. Introduced to loneliness and despair, he looks for someone, anyone to help him. And wouldn't he know, the person he was looking for was also looking for him, well looking at him, from afar. Alone they couldn't do much. But together they'll grow bonds thicker than steel.
